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will inspect your property to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water pockets and ensure thorough drying. Get a clear understanding of the situation. Identify the source of the leak. Plan the extraction process.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ced equipment, such as truck-mounted pumps and portable extractors, to quickly remove excess water from your property.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as soon as possible. Extract water quickly and safely. Prevent further damage. Get back to normal life sooner.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, preventing mold growth and further damage. We’ll work to ensure your property is thoroughly dried and safe for occupation. Prevent mold growth. Ensure thorough drying. Guarantee a safe environment.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ll use specialized equipment and products to sanitize and disinfect your property, removing any remaining moisture and preventing bacterial growth. Our team will work to ensure your property is safe and healthy for occupation. Sanitize and disinfect your property. Remove any remaining moisture. Guarantee a healthy environment.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s a sign that there’s moisture present in your property. Don’t ignore this warning sign, it can lead to mold growth and further damage. Identify the source of the moisture. Call our team to assess the situation. Pr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a more serious issue, hidden water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Identify the source of the leak. Call our team to assess the situation. Pr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int and Warped Wood
Peeling paint and warped wood can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Identify the source of the moisture. Call our team to assess the situation. Prevent further damage.

|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water present and the equipment needed to extract it.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ry and dehumidify it. |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The cost of sanitizing and disinfecting depends on the size of the affected area and the products needed to sanitize and disinfect it. |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The cost of restoration and repair depends on the ext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ore and repair it. |
| Assessment and inspection | $500 – $2,000 | The cost of assessment and inspection depends on the complexity of the situation and the expertise needed to assess and inspect it. |
